Park Yu..Historical records describe him as a divine anchorite who appears to have been greatly respected. Frustrated with Goongyae’s tyranny, he would disappear from the world about this time and reappear when Wang Guhn is elevated to the throne. Like this, Park Yu leaves the palace in search of the master healer, never to return. This would be another devastating loss for Jongkahn.
The word “anchorite” we’ve come across before; it means religious recluse, kind of like a hermit. We know he was a high scholar also, which would have been how he got his reputation.
